Job description

Overview:

Kimley-Horn is looking for Environmental Science graduates with 2+ years of experience to join our Phoenix, AZ office! This is not a remote position. 

Responsibilities:
  • Solve complex problems, assist project managers, and collaborate across disciplines to produce our clients’ visions for the future built environment.
  • Develop familiarity with the federal, state, and local regulations, as well as Kimley-Horn’s and our client’s practices, procedures, and standards.
  • The opportunity to gain knowledge in one or more of the following: natural resource regulations, water quality regulatory programs, wetlands identification including knowledge of botany and soil science and experience in ecology, wildlife biology, water resources, geographic information systems and environmental science.
  • Some travel may be required (approximately 10%).
Qualifications:
  • 2+ years relevant experience, including state and federal wetland and species permitting requirements
  • Bachelors or Masters Degree in relevant majors including Biology, Environmental Science, or related majors
  • Ecological field work experience, including wetland delineation and protected species survey 
  • Possess strong technical writing skills and have knowledge writing detailed technical reports 
  • Working knowledge and strong interest in ArcGIS
  • Desire to work in both an office environment and in the field
  • Willingness and flexibility to travel for projects as needed
  • Excellent verbal, written and interpersonal skills
  • Strong sense of urgency and self-initiative to meet client deadlines
  • Detail-oriented team player with the ability to contribute to a positive work environment
  • Strong technical writing and organizational skills
  • The ability to work effectively in a fast-paced work environment as well as the ability to manage and prioritize several assignments concurrently and meet deadlines
